Treatments and Surgeries
-
Stone disease
-
URS/RIRS with laser lithotripsy for ureteric/renal stones.
-
PCNL/mini‑PCNL for large or complex renal stones.
-
ESWL (where available) for selected stones with non-invasive fragmentation.
-
Prostate and bladder outlet
-
TURP/laser prostatectomy (Holmium/Thulium) for BPH with durable symptom relief.
-
Bladder neck incision/management of strictures with endoscopic techniques.
-
Uro-oncology
-
TURBT for bladder tumors; partial/radical nephrectomy; radical prostatectomy; orchiectomy for testicular tumors.
-
Intravesical therapies and systemic treatment coordination with oncology.
-
Reconstructive urology
-
Urethroplasty for anterior/posterior strictures; fistula repairs; complex redo procedures.
-
Female urology
-
Sling procedures for stress incontinence; cystocele/rectocele repairs with pelvic floor rehabilitation.
-
Pediatric urology
-
Hypospadias repair, orchiopexy, VUR management, pediatric stone surgery.
-
Andrology
-
Penile prosthesis for refractory erectile dysfunction; varicocele repair; surgical sperm retrieval (as indicated).

Stone prevention program
-
Metabolic evaluation (stone composition, serum/urine studies) to identify recurrence risks.
-
Diet and hydration guidance, citrate therapy plans, and follow-up imaging schedules.

FAQs
-
Are laser procedures painful?
Discomfort is usually minimal; anesthesia and modern techniques help ensure comfort and faster recovery.
-
Will a stent be needed after stone surgery?
Temporary stents are used selectively; removal is planned and explained in advance.
-
Can prostate symptoms be managed without surgery?
Many patients improve with medicines and lifestyle changes; surgery is reserved for specific indications.
-
What prevents stone recurrence?
Hydration, diet, and individualized metabolic therapy significantly reduce recurrence risk.
-
Is day-care discharge safe?
Discharge follows standardized criteria with clear aftercare and emergency contact instructions.
